Have 1 wired PC connected to the RBR. Turn OFF all RBS and disconnect ALL wired devices from the RBR. Disconnect the RBR from the ISP modem.
Press the reset button for 20 seconds then release.
Use a web browser and poing to 192.168.1.1...should bring up a setup wizard.

One of my satellites is still showing as "Out of Sync" -- I've tried to sync a dozen-ish times. I've followed all the tips in the community, but no joy. Any ideas?Fortunately, doing a factory reset on a satellite is 'practically painless'.
- Power the satellite off so that in a few minutes it shows 'disconnected' and asks if you want to remove it.
- Remove it.
- Use the paperclip to factory reset the satellite when it is powered up again.
- Select the "Add Orbi Satellite" from the main web menu and add it.
